<br /> <br />Franchise Transfers: <br />If Comcast or CenturyLink should want to transfer ownership of their Twin Cities area <br />business, it requires that Cities go through a prescribed legal process. Not unlike <br />franchise renewal it requires that the franchising authorities do a complex review of the <br />new company's ability to operated the system from an administrative, technical, and <br />financial perspective. This is also a time for negotiating franchise violations. This <br />happened recently with the proposed Comcast/Time Warner sale. We settled several <br />outstanding issues with Comcast and as a result were able to extend our franchise with <br />Comcast by three years. This saved money in the short term, and guaranteed fee <br />payments for the additional time frame.
